Alternative Methods of Composting for Small Spaces or Urban Environments

In this article, we will explore alternative methods of composting that are suitable for individuals living in small spaces or urban environments. Composting is the process of decomposing organic matter, such as kitchen scraps, yard waste, and other biodegradable materials, into nutrient-rich soil known as compost. While traditional composting methods often require large outdoor spaces, there are several alternative methods that can be implemented in limited spaces without compromising the benefits of composting.

1. Vermicomposting

Vermicomposting, also known as worm composting, is a popular alternative method for composting in small spaces. It involves using specific species of worms, such as red wigglers, to break down organic waste. A worm bin or a specially designed vermicomposting system is used to house the worms and the waste. The worms consume the organic matter and produce nutrient-rich worm castings, which can be used as compost in gardens or potted plants.

Vermicomposting has several advantages for small spaces or urban environments. It can be done indoors, making it suitable for apartments or homes without access to outdoor areas. Additionally, the process is relatively odorless and can be managed with minimal effort. However, it is important to properly maintain the worm bin and provide the worms with a suitable environment, including appropriate bedding materials and regular feeding.

2. Bokashi Composting

Bokashi composting is another alternative method that is suitable for small spaces or urban living. This method utilizes a specific type of composting system known as a bokashi bucket. Bokashi is a Japanese term that translates to "fermented organic matter." In this process, food waste and other organic materials are placed in an airtight container, where they undergo fermentation with the help of beneficial microorganisms.

The bokashi system requires the use of a bokashi bran or a fermenting starter culture, which is sprinkled over the organic waste to accelerate the fermentation process. The waste is placed in layers and covered with the bran or culture. The fermentation process breaks down the waste, preserving the nutrients and preventing the release of unpleasant odors. Once the bokashi bucket is filled, the fermented waste can be buried in soil or added to an outdoor compost pile to complete the composting process.

Bokashi composting has several advantages for small spaces. It can be done indoors without producing any noticeable odors, making it ideal for apartments or homes with limited outdoor access. The process is relatively fast, with the fermented waste transforming into compost within a few weeks or months, depending on the conditions. The resulting compost is highly concentrated and can be mixed with soil to enrich its nutrient content.

3. Composting in Small Outdoor Spaces

If you have a small outdoor space, such as a balcony, patio, or rooftop, there are still options for composting. One method is to use a compost tumbler or a compost bin specifically designed for small spaces. These containers allow for efficient composting while minimizing the required space. The composting process can be accelerated by regularly turning or rotating the contents of the tumbler.

Another option for small outdoor spaces is to create a compost pile directly on the ground. This can be done by designating a small area for composting and layering organic waste with dry materials, such as leaves or shredded paper. It is important to maintain the proper balance of organic materials and moisture for effective composting. Regularly turning the pile helps facilitate decomposition and prevent odors.

4. Community Composting

If individual composting is challenging in your small space or urban environment, consider participating in community composting initiatives. Many cities and communities offer programs where residents can drop off their compostable materials at designated locations. These materials are then processed in large-scale composting facilities, resulting in high-quality compost that can be used in community gardens or distributed to participants.

Community composting allows individuals without access to outdoor spaces or suitable composting methods to still contribute to the composting process. It promotes a sense of community involvement and sustainability, while also reducing the amount of waste sent to landfills.
